Advertisement
Guest User

Untitled

a guest
Jul 23rd, 2017
62
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.87 KB | None | 0 0
  1. @echo off
  2.  
  3. REM This script manually updates the NT master server list IP address.
  4. REM To run, place inside "Steam\steamapps\common\NEOTOKYO" and doubleclick.
  5.  
  6. IF NOT EXIST "%~dp0\hl2.exe" (
  7. ECHO This script needs to be placed in Steam\steamapps\common\NEOTOKYO.
  8. ECHO Press any key to exit...
  9. PAUSE > NUL
  10. EXIT
  11. )
  12.  
  13. SET masterDNS=hl2master.steampowered.com
  14. SET masterPort=27011
  15.  
  16. SET vdfPath=.\platform\config\
  17. SET vdfFile=masterservers.vdf
  18.  
  19. ECHO Finding master IP from %masterDNS%...
  20. FOR /F "TOKENS=3" %%A IN ('PING -n 1 %masterDNS%') DO SET "ipv4=%%A" & GOTO CONTINUE
  21.  
  22. :CONTINUE
  23. ECHO New master IP is %ipv4:~1,-1%.
  24. ECHO.
  25.  
  26. SET vdfBuffer="MasterServers"^{^ "hl2"^ {^ "0"^ {^ "addr" "%ipv4:~1,-1%:%masterPort%"^ }^ }^}
  27.  
  28. ECHO Storing master IP to Neotokyo's %vdfFile%...
  29. ECHO %vdfBuffer% > %vdfPath%%vdfFile%
  30. ECHO Done!
  31. ECHO.
  32.  
  33. ECHO Press any key to exit...
  34. PAUSE > NUL
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ement